Comprehending Eligibility Requirements

Before initiating your online application, it is essential to figure out whether you satisfy the basic eligibility requirements for a UK driving licence. Candidates should be at least 17 years of age to drive a vehicle on public roadways, though you can apply for a provisional licence as much as 3 months before your 17th birthday. For bike licence applications, the minimum age differs depending upon the engine size and kind of bike you mean to ride, varying from 16 for mopeds to 21 for certain high-performance machines.

Beyond age requirements, candidates must normally be resident in Great Britain and meet the minimum residency requirements. You need to have a legitimate UK house authorization and have actually been living in the UK for a minimum of 185 days at the start of your application. In addition, you should not be disqualified from driving by a court order or have a licence that is currently suspended or revoked in another UK country. Medical physical fitness requirements likewise apply, and you should declare any medical conditions that could affect your ability to drive securely. The DVLA provides comprehensive assistance on medical conditions that require statement, and in some cases, you might require to offer extra medical paperwork from your doctor.

European Economic Area (EEA) licence holders may have the ability to exchange their existing licence for a UK equivalent without taking a driving test, though this alternative undergoes particular time frame following your establishment of residency in the UK. Understanding these eligibility requirements before you start your application will avoid hold-ups and prospective rejection of your submission.

Files and Information Required

The online application procedure requires a number of pieces of individual details and supporting paperwork to validate your identity and eligibility. Having these products all set before you begin will ensure a smooth application experience.

The DVLA utilizes the DVLA Secure Identity Check (SIC) service to validate your identity online, which includes inspecting your passport information against government records. If you do not have a UK passport, alternative recognition files might be appropriate, though the procedure may take longer.

You will likewise require your National Insurance number, which functions as a distinct identifier in the UK tax and benefit system. If you have lost or forgotten your National Insurance number, you can locate it on payslips, tax files, or by getting in touch with HM Revenue and Customs directly. Addresses for the previous three years must be supplied, as the DVLA needs a total domestic history to confirm your identity and residency status.

For newbie candidates, you will require to offer a digital photograph if you are not utilizing your passport for identity verification. This picture can be taken using a smart device or web electronic camera during the application process, though it must satisfy specific requirements relating to lighting, background, and facial positioning. The online system supplies assistance to help you catch an appropriate photo.

The Online Application Process

Navigating the DVLA's online portal is straightforward, though understanding each step will help you finish your application efficiently. The service is accessed through the official GOV.UK site, and it is crucial to guarantee you are utilizing the official federal government website to safeguard your individual details.

The application begins with selecting the type of driving licence you require. The system guides you through choices including first-time provisionary licences, updating from provisional to complete licence, renewing an existing licence, and replacing lost, stolen, or harmed licences. Each application type has a little various requirements and charge structures, so choosing the proper alternative is important.

After selecting your application type, the system prompts you to produce an account or check in if you currently have one. Your DVLA account works as a secure portal for handling your driving licence and vehicle-related services, and it permits you to track the progress of your application. Throughout the application, you will be asked to validate your identity, offer your individual details, state any medical conditions, and publish any necessary photographs or supporting documents.

Payment for a lot of driving licence applications is made online using a debit or credit card. The DVLA accepts most major payment techniques, and you will receive a confirmation e-mail detailing your payment and application submission. After submitting your application, you can log into your DVLA account to examine the status of your licence application at any time.

When You Can not Apply Online

While the online service covers most driving licence applications, certain circumstances need alternative application methods. If you have a medical condition that requires particular documentation, you might require to finish a paper application so that your doctor can offer the required medical reports directly to the DVLA. Likewise, if your licence has actually been revoked or suspended and you are reapplying, the paper application procedure enables for more detailed review of your circumstances.

Motorists who have actually changed their name through marital relationship, civil collaboration, or deed survey may require to offer additional documents that can not be published through the online system. In these cases, the DVLA may need original documents to be published to their workplaces, which will extend your processing time. Those requiring to exchange an EEA licence for a UK licence are also directed to specific paper applications in particular circumstances, especially for licences that do not include an image or that were provided before particular dates.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does it require to receive my driving licence after applying online?

The majority of online applications for driving licence renewals and replacements are processed within five working days, with the licence getting here by post within 2 weeks of approval. First-time applications and cases needing extra verification might take three to 4 weeks. You can track the progress of your application through your DVLA online account.

Can I drive while my application is being processed?

If you are restoring an existing licence and your application is for a picture card renewal without any modifications, you can continue driving while awaiting your new licence to show up, provided your present licence is not expired. If you are obtaining your very first complete licence, you need to have passed both the theory and useful driving tests before you can drive legally. Provisionary licence holders should constantly be accompanied by a certified driver when practising.

What should I do if my application is rejected or delayed?

If your application is rejected, the DVLA will send you a letter describing the factor and what additional info or documents is needed. Common reasons for rejection include stopped working identity verification, insufficient medical statements, or unsatisfactory photos. You can generally supply extra details online through your DVLA account. Processing delays can occur throughout peak durations or if additional confirmation is needed, and you need to contact the DVLA if your application exceeds the mentioned processing timeframes.

Do I require to renew my driving licence when I alter my address?

Yes, you should notify the DVLA of any modification of address, and this can be done online through your DVLA account. The licence itself does not require to be replaced unless you desire an updated photocard showing your new address, which is optional. Nevertheless, you should ensure the DVLA has your existing address on record, as your licence and correspondence will be sent out to the address they have on file. Changing your address is free of charge when done online.

What identification documents are accepted for the DVLA Secure Identity Check?

The favored document is a valid UK passport, as this permits immediate digital confirmation. If you do not have a UK passport, alternative files such as a legitimate UK biometric house license, an EU/EEA nationwide identity card, or specific travel documents may be acceptable. Nevertheless, these options may require extra verification actions and could extend your processing time. The DVLA supplies a total list of appropriate files on their website.

Keeping Your Driving Licence

After effectively obtaining or restoring your driving licence, remaining informed about your continuous responsibilities helps ensure you remain legally certified. Your photocard driving licence must be restored every 10 years, and the DVLA will send you a pointer letter when your renewal is due. In addition, you need to inform the DVLA if your personal details alter, if you establish a medical condition that might impact your driving, or if you build up penalty points that reach 12 or more within three years.
